Note this about Andrew Warren-
Warren continues his quest to come back from a broken foot, at least until Jan. 10 when a medical hardship decision must be made.
'He did quite a bit on the side (Monday),' Les said. 'It was a pretty intense workout and he's been pain free. But he still hasn't done anything with the team in practice.'
Therefore, while Warren made the trip, he won't play, Les said.
'That's only fair to him and to the team to add a guy they haven't played with in a long time. Before he gets on the floor, we'll make sure he's comfortable mentally and physically in practice.'
